Swans on the net

In these notes last April, I wrote that my Internet site had recorded 50,000 visitors since its inception in January 1996. Last month, the 75,000 mark was reached - such is the interest in news of the Swans.

However, this popularity is not just down to facts, match reports and video clips alone. There is a "fun section" where you can download Swans screensavers (for free).

In addition, there is a "tongue in cheek" look at the personalities involved backstage at the Vetch in a cartoon strip called the "Swansons." As my artistic skills are on a par with a Bluebird reserve player's ball skills, these characters look remarkably like the "Simpsons" cartoons .

One interactive featured that I recently introduced has proved to be really popular – the Predicatsco competition.

Currently there are 113 taking part. Points are awarded for predicting the correct result and score of our matches. Neil McClure, himself a big fan of the Internet, has kindly agreed to donate a replica Swans top to be used as the first prize at the end of the season.
